Recovery Trajectory of Range of Motion and Its Association With Patient Factors During Early Postoperative Stiffness After Arthroscopic Rotator Cuff Repair

Orthopaedic journal of sports medicine · 2026

Nearly half of cuff repair patients have early stiffness, and those whose stiffness is pain-driven (not fear-driven) are the ones likely to stay stiff at 6 months.

Retrospective cohort, n=352 patients who underwent arthroscopic complete repair of full-thickness rotator cuff tears.

46.9% (165/352) met stiffness criteria at 3 months; among these, 20.6% (34/165) had persistent stiffness at 6 months. Higher VAS pain at 3 months independently predicted persistence (OR 1.44, 95% CI 1.01-2.05, P=.044). Fear/anxiety about retear was the most common reported barrier to rehab overall (50.3%) but was largely reversible; pain was a less common barrier (32.7%) but was over-represented among patients who went on to have persistent stiffness, cited by 67.6% of that group. Note this 67.6% figure describes the composition of the persistent-stiffness group, not a persistence rate conditional on having pain as the barrier, so it shouldn't be read as 'two-thirds of pain-driven patients stay stiff.'

Single-centre retrospective cohort study, Level of evidence 3, n=352, patients who underwent arthroscopic repair of full-thickness rotator cuff tears at what appears to be one institution.

This is retrospective chart review with all the usual limitations: no protocolised rehab standardisation described, no blinding of ROM/outcome assessors, and the 'primary barrier to rehabilitation' at 3 months is a single self-reported item with no validated instrument or details on how it was elicited, so recall and reporting bias are real risks. The OR of 1.44 has a CI that only just clears 1 (1.01-2.05) and the P value is.044, meaning this is a fragile, borderline-significant finding in a multivariate model whose other covariates and adjustment quality aren't described in the abstract. No mention of loss to follow-up, inter-rater reliability for ROM measurement, or external validation, and single-surgeon/single-centre cohorts often don't generalise to other rehab protocols.

The OR of 1.44 per unit VAS increase is statistically significant but barely so, and translating a VAS-score odds ratio into a clinically meaningful prediction rule is not straightforward; the abstract offers no sensitivity/specificity or a usable pain cutoff a clinician could act on at 3 months. The design is associative, not causal, so this identifies a possible marker of persistent stiffness rather than proving pain drives it, and the interesting qualitative observation (fear-avoidance is common but reversible, pain-driven stiffness persists) is descriptive rather than tested against a comparator.

The primary barrier variable is a single retrospective self-report with no described measurement method, and the predictive model isn't validated or given a clinically usable threshold, so you cannot yet tell a patient with X pain score they have Y% risk of persistent stiffness.

This sits within the existing literature on stiffness incidence after arthroscopic rotator cuff repair and early passive ROM protocols; it adds a pain-versus-fear phenotyping angle to that picture rather than overturning established early mobilisation evidence.

In the subset of patients still meeting stiffness criteria at 3 months (roughly half of repairs), use pain as a soft flag: those citing pain rather than fear/anxiety as their main barrier are the ones more likely to remain stiff at 6 months, so escalate pain management and desensitisation-focused rehab for that group rather than just pushing harder into stretch. This doesn't yet justify a new screening tool or a formal protocol change given the borderline statistics (OR CI 1.01-2.05) and single retrospective cohort.

Applies to the roughly half of arthroscopic cuff repair patients still meeting stiffness criteria at 3 months, not to routine post-op shoulders generally. In clinic, use the 3-month review to ask what's actually limiting movement: fear/anxiety about the repair responds to reassurance and graded exposure and usually resolves on its own, but a patient who names pain as the main barrier needs escalated pain control and desensitisation work rather than more aggressive stretching, since that's the subgroup still stiff at 6 months. Track recovery with serial Flexion, External rotation and Internal rotation measures (the same thresholds the study used to define stiffness) at 3 and 6 months so escalation is triggered by numbers rather than how the shoulder feels that day. For S&C coaches picking these athletes up for return-to-performance work, treat a pain-driven stiff shoulder as the one to slow down on overhead or pressing progression while a fear-driven stiff shoulder mainly needs confidence-building load exposure; either way this is a weak, single-cohort signal (OR CI 1.01-2.05), so use it to prioritise conversations, not as a formal gate.
